ATV Rentals in Girdwood, Alaska
Girdwood is one of our two pickup points. Collect the machine yourself and ride on your own schedule, or skip the logistics with a delivered trailhead package.
Pickup rentals run in 24-hour blocks. You collect your ATV or UTV in Girdwood during our evening window, between 6 PM and 9 PM, and return it 24 hours later unless you booked multiple days. Book 1 to 5 days directly online. For 6 days or longer, text us and we will build the reservation by hand using our published multi-day, extended and monthly rates.
A helmet is included with every rental. Delivery can be added to a pickup rental for $1.50 per mile when available, and a trailer is available as an add-on.
The closest trail is Bird Creek, 13 miles north, with 15 miles of forest trail in Chugach State Park. The Old Sterling Highway route is 55 miles south, and the AKMUDITUP guided tour meets 15 miles away at Milepost 75.

The guided option
If you would rather ride with a guide the whole way, our AKMUDITUP tour crosses the Turnagain Arm tidelands over about 3 hours, with rain gear and boots provided, at $365 per person.
